Truma Combi 4E combined water and air heater (including Kit)
Like all Combi models, Truma Combi 4E combines space and water heating in one appliance. The 4000-watt heater provides comfortable warmth in your vehicle in just a few minutes. It also heats the water that you need for showering, washing dishes or washing your hands. And the best thing about it, you only have to install one appliance in your caravan or motor home. This saves space and weight. The temperature in the vehicle is infinitely adjustable with a digital control panel.
Features
- Integrated heating elements for additional electrical mode
- Heats the vehicle and water very quickly
- Uses little energy
- Many installation options, as it is incredibly lightweight and compact
- The warm air from Combi 4E is distributed optimally via four air outlets
- Gas, electrical and mixed modes are possible
- Frost Control automatically empties the water tank in cold weather

Specifications
- Energy sources: LPG + electricity
- Operating pressure: 30 mbar
- Rated heat output in gas mode: 2000 W / 4000 W
- Rated heat output in electric mode: 900 W / 1800 W
- Rated heat output in mixed mode: max. 3800 W
- Fuel consumption: 160 – 335 g/h
- Power consumption (at 12 v) operation of heater and water container: max. 6.5 A for short periods (average approx. 1.2 A)
- Power consumption (at 230 V): 3.9 A / 7.8 A
- Water capacity: 10 litres
- Heating time (from approx. 15 °C to approx. 60 °C): Water container: approx. 23 min.
- Heating time (from approx. 15 °C to approx. 60 °C): Heater and water container: approx. 80 min.
- Weight: approx. 15.5 kg
- Dimensions: (L x W x H) 510 x 450 x 300 mm
